S.43: A bill to amend title 10, United States Code, to authorize certain disabled former prisoners of war to use Department of Defense commissary and exchange stores.

Bill Summary
Authorizes use of Department of Defense commissary and exchange stores by former prisoners of war who have been honorably separated from service and have a service-connected disability rated at 30 percent or more.
